[Note Guidelines] Photographer's Note
An Australian family portrait I took last month.
I've noticed it can be quite effective to have people in the photo all focusing on one person (usually a child) so I tried that here. It's also important to show connectivity in the family so asked everyone to get in close and touch each other.
While the original was taken outside in their garden, I decided I could do better with the background - and ended up selecting around them and compositing them onto a new background - a shot of the rainforest I took in Borneo! I blurred it somewhat, to hopefully get a technically accurate picture.

Well, I am going to risk being honest and say that, while I was impressed with your last, uhm, many posts, I am not so impressed with this one. It is quite original in as much as it doesn't present all embers of the family smiling straight into the camera, but it lacks the visual appeal of your other images. The diagonal works well, the little boy in the center attracts the view a bit, but the faces turned away from the camera let my eye glide over the image in search of more to look at. The colors are a bit washed out and enhance the overall impression. Hope you don't mind an honest opinion. The replacement of the background worked out very well, my untrained eye can’t notice any flaws even now that I know it’s a collage.
